# Organization bootstrap
2022-02-06 01:50:23 -08:00
The primary purpose of this stage is to enable critical organization-level functionalities that depend on broad administrative permissions, and prepare the prerequisites needed to enable automation in this and future stages.
It is intentionally simple, to minimize usage of administrative-level permissions and enable simple auditing and troubleshooting, and only deals with three sets of resources:
- project, service accounts, and GCS buckets for automation
- projects, BQ datasets, and sinks for audit log and billing exports
- IAM bindings on the organization
Use the following diagram as a simple high level reference for the following sections, which describe the stage and its possible customizations in detail.

## Design overview and choices
As mentioned above, this stage only does the bare minimum required to bootstrap automation, and ensure that base audit and billing exports are in place from the start to provide some measure of accountability, even before the security configurations are applied in a later stage.

It also sets up organization-level IAM bindings so the Organization Administrator role is only used here, trading off some design freedom for ease of auditing and troubleshooting, and reducing the risk of costly security mistakes down the line. The only exception to this rule is for the [Resource Management stage](../1-resman) service account, described below.
### User groups
User groups are important, not only here but throughout the whole automation process. They provide a stable frame of reference that allows decoupling the final set of permissions for each group, from the stage where entities and resources are created and their IAM bindings defined. For example, the final set of roles for the networking group is contributed by this stage at the organization level (XPN Admin, Cloud Asset Viewer, etc.), and by the Resource Management stage at the folder level.
We have standardized the initial set of groups on those outlined in the [GCP Enterprise Setup Checklist](https://cloud.google.com/docs/enterprise/setup-checklist) to simplify adoption. They provide a comprehensive and flexible starting point that can suit most users. Adding new groups, or deviating from the initial setup is possible and reasonably simple, and it's briefly outlined in the customization section below.
### Organization-level IAM

The service account used in the [Resource Management stage](../1-resman) needs to be able to grant specific permissions at the organizational level, to enable specific functionality for subsequent stages that deal with network or security resources, or billing-related activities.
In order to be able to assign those roles without having the full authority of the Organization Admin role, this stage defines a custom role that only allows setting IAM policies on the organization, and grants it via a [delegated role grant](https://cloud.google.com/iam/docs/setting-limits-on-granting-roles) that only allows it to be used to grant a limited subset of roles.

In this way, the Resource Management service account can effectively act as an Organization Admin, but only to grant the specific roles it needs to control.

One consequence of the above setup is the need to configure IAM bindings that can be assigned via the condition as non-authoritative, since those same roles are effectively under the control of two stages: this one and Resource Management. Using authoritative bindings for these roles (instead of non-authoritative ones) would generate potential conflicts, where each stage could try to overwrite and negate the bindings applied by the other at each `apply` cycle.
A full reference of IAM roles managed by this stage [is available here](./IAM.md).
### Organization policies and tag-based conditions
It's often desirable to have organization policies deployed before any other resource in the org, so as to ensure compliance with specific requirements (e.g. location restrictions), or control the configuration of specific resources (e.g. default network at project creation or service account grants).

To cover this use case, organization policies have been moved from the resource management to the bootstrap stage in FAST versions after 26.0.0. They are managed via the usual factory approach, and a [sample set of data files](./data/org-policies/) is included with this stage. They are not applied during the initial run when the `bootstrap_user` variable is set, to work around incompatibilities with user credentials.
The only current exception to the factory approach is the `iam.allowedPolicyMemberDomains` constraint, which is managed in code so as to be able to auto-allow the organization's domain. More domains can be added via the `org_policies_config` variable, which also serves as an umbrella for future policies that will need to be managed in code.
Organization policy exceptions are managed via a dedicated resource management tag hierarchy, rooted in the `org-policies` tag key. A default condition is already present for the the `iam.allowedPolicyMemberDomains` constraint, that relaxes the policy on resources that have the `org-policies/allowed-policy-member-domains-all` tag value bound or inherited.
Further tag values can be defined via the `org_policies_config.tag_values` variable, and IAM access can be granted on them via the same variable. Once a tag value has been created, its id can be used in constraint rule conditions.
Management of the rest of the tag hierarchy is delegated to the resource management stage, as that is often intimately tied to the folder hierarchy design.
The organization policy tag key and values managed by this stage have been added to the `0-bootstrap.auto.tfvars` stage, so that IAM can be delegated to the resource management or successive stages via their ids.
The following example shows an example on how to define an additional tag value, and use it in a boolean constraint rule.
This snippet defines a new tag value under the `org-policies` tag key via the `org_policies_config` variable, and assigns the permission to bind it to a group.
```hcl
# stage 0 custom tfvars
org_policies_config = {
tag_values = {
compute-require-oslogin-false = {
description = "Bind this tag to set oslogin to false."
iam = {
"roles/resourcemanager.tagUser" = [
"group:foo@example.com"
]
}
}
}
}
# tftest skip
```
The above tag can be used to define a constraint condition via the `data/org-policies/compute.yaml` or similar factory file. The id in the condition is the organization id, followed by the name of the organization policy tag key (defaults to `org-policies`).
```yaml
compute.requireOsLogin:
rules:
- enforce: true
- enforce: false
condition:
expression: resource.matchTag('12345678/org-policies-config', 'compute-require-oslogin-false')
```
### Automation project and resources
One other design choice worth mentioning here is using a single automation project for all foundational stages. We trade off some complexity on the API side (single source for usage quota, multiple service activation) for increased flexibility and simpler operations, while still effectively providing the same degree of separation via resource-level IAM.
### Billing account
We support three use cases in regards to billing:
- the billing account is part of this same organization, IAM bindings will be set at the organization level
- the billing account is not considered part of an organization (even though it might be), billing IAM bindings are set on the billing account itself
- billing IAM is managed separately, and no bindings should (or can) be set via Terraform, this requires a few extra steps and is definitely not recommended and mainly used for development purposes
For same-organization billing, we configure a custom organization role that can set IAM bindings, via a delegated role grant to limit its scope to the relevant roles.
For details on configuring the different billing account modes, refer to the [How to run this stage](#how-to-run-this-stage) section below.
Because of limitations of API availability, manual steps have to be followed to enable billing export within billing project to BigQuery dataset `billing_export` which will be created as part of the bootstrap stage. The process to share billing data [is outlined here](https://cloud.google.com/billing/docs/how-to/export-data-bigquery-setup#enable-bq-export).

### Organization-level logging

We create organization-level log sinks early in the bootstrap process to ensure a proper audit trail is in place from the very beginning. By default, we provide log filters to capture [Cloud Audit Logs](https://cloud.google.com/logging/docs/audit), [VPC Service Controls violations](https://cloud.google.com/vpc-service-controls/docs/troubleshooting#vpc-sc-errors) and [Workspace Logs](https://cloud.google.com/logging/docs/audit/configure-gsuite-audit-logs) into logging buckets in the top-level audit logging project.

### Naming
We are intentionally not supporting random prefix/suffixes for names, as that is an antipattern typically only used in development. It does not map to our customer's actual production usage, where they always adopt a fixed naming convention.
What is implemented here is a fairly common convention, composed of tokens ordered by relative importance:
- an organization-level static prefix less or equal to 9 characters (e.g. `myco` or `myco-gcp`)
- an optional tenant-level prefix, if using multitenant stages
- an environment identifier (e.g. `prod`)
- a team/owner identifier (e.g. `sec` for Security)
- a context identifier (e.g. `core` or `kms`)
- an arbitrary identifier used to distinguish similar resources (e.g. `0`, `1`)
Tokens are joined by a `-` character, making it easy to separate the individual tokens visually, and to programmatically split them in billing exports to derive initial high-level groupings for cost attribution.
The convention is used in its full form only for specific resources with globally unique names (projects, GCS buckets). Other resources adopt a shorter version for legibility, as the full context can always be derived from their project.
The [Customizations](#names-and-naming-convention) section on names below explains how to configure tokens, or implement a different naming convention.
### Workforce Identity Federation
This stage supports configuration of [Workforce Identity Federation](https://cloud.google.com/iam/docs/workforce-identity-federation) which lets an external identity provider (IdP) to authenticate and authorize a group of users (usually employees) using IAM, so that the users can access Google Cloud services.
The following example shows an example on how to define a Workforce Identity pool for the organization.
```hcl
# stage 0 wif tfvars
workforce_identity_providers = {
test = {
issuer = "azuread"
display_name = "wif-provider"
description = "Workforce Identity pool"
saml = {
idp_metadata_xml = "<?xml version=\"1.0\" encoding=\"utf-8\"?>..."
}
}
}
# tftest skip
```

## How to run this stage
This stage has straightforward initial requirements, as it is designed to work on newly created GCP organizations. Four steps are needed to bring up this stage:
- an Organization Admin self-assigns the required roles listed below
- the same administrator runs the first `init/apply` sequence passing a special variable to `apply`
- the providers configuration file is derived from the Terraform output or linked from the generated file
- a second `init` is run to migrate state, and from then on, the stage is run via impersonation
### Prerequisites
The roles that the Organization Admin used in the first `apply` needs to self-grant are:
- Billing Account Administrator (`roles/billing.admin`)
either on the organization or the billing account (see the following section for details)
- Logging Admin (`roles/logging.admin`)
- Organization Role Administrator (`roles/iam.organizationRoleAdmin`)
- Organization Administrator (`roles/resourcemanager.organizationAdmin`)
- Project Creator (`roles/resourcemanager.projectCreator`)
- Tag Admin (`roles/resourcemanager.tagAdmin`)

#### Preventing creation of billing-related IAM bindings
This configuration is possible but unsupported and only present for development purposes, use at your own risk:
- configure `billing_account.id` as `null` and `billing.no_iam` to `true` in your `tfvars` file
- apply with `terraform apply -target 'module.automation-project.google_project.project[0]'` in addition to the initial user variable
- once Terraform raises an error run `terraform untaint 'module.automation-project.google_project.project[0]'`
- repeat the two steps above for `'module.log-export-project.google_project.project[0]'`
- go through the process to associate the billing account with the two projects
- configure `billing_account.id` with the real billing account id
- resume applying normally

## Customizations
Most variables (e.g. `billing_account` and `organization`) are only used to input actual values and should be self-explanatory. The only meaningful customizations that apply here are groups, and IAM roles.
### Group names
As we mentioned above, groups reflect the convention used in the [GCP Enterprise Setup Checklist](https://cloud.google.com/docs/enterprise/setup-checklist), with an added level of indirection: the `groups` variable maps logical names to actual names, so that you don't need to delve into the code if your group names do not comply with the checklist convention.
For example, if your network admins team is called `net-rockstars@example.com`, simply set that name in the variable, minus the domain which is interpolated internally with the organization domain:
```hcl
variable "groups" {
description = "Group names to grant organization-level permissions."
type = map(string)
default = {
2022-12-17 09:54:18 -08:00
gcp-network-admins = "net-rockstars"
# [...]
}
}
2022-12-17 09:54:18 -08:00
# tftest skip
```
If your groups layout differs substantially from the checklist, define all relevant groups in the `groups` variable, then rearrange IAM roles in the code to match your setup.
### IAM
One other area where we directly support customizations is IAM. The code here, as in all stages, follows a simple pattern derived from best practices:
- operational roles for humans are assigned to groups
- any other principal is a service account
In code, the distinction above reflects on how IAM bindings are specified in the underlying module variables:
- group roles "for humans" always use `iam_groups` variables
- service account roles always use `iam` variables
This makes it easy to tweak user roles by adding mappings to the `iam_groups` variables of the relevant resources, without having to understand and deal with the details of service account roles.

One more critical difference in IAM bindings is between authoritative and additive:

- authoritative bindings have complete control on principals for a given role; this is the recommended best practice when a single automation actor controls the role, as it removes drift each time Terraform runs
- additive bindings have control only on given role/principal pairs, and need to be used whenever multiple automation actors need to control the role, as is the case for the network user role in Shared VPC setups, and many other situations

This stage groups all IAM definitions in the [organization-iam.tf](./organization-iam.tf) file, to allow easy parsing of roles assigned to each group and machine identity.
When customizations are needed, three stage-level variables allow injecting additional bindings to match the desired setup:
- `group_iam` allows adding authoritative bindings for groups
- `iam` allows adding authoritative bindings for any type of supported principal, and is merged with the internal `iam` local and then with group bindings at the module level
- `iam_bindings_additive` allows adding individual role/member pairs, and also supports IAM conditions
Refer to the [project module](../../../modules/project/) for examples on how to use the IAM variables, and they are an interface shared across all our modules.

### Names and naming convention
Configuring the individual tokens for the naming convention described above, has varying degrees of complexity:
- the static prefix can be set via the `prefix` variable once
- the environment identifier is set to `prod` as resources here influence production and are considered as such, and can be changed in `main.tf` locals
All other tokens are set directly in resource names, as providing abstractions to manage them would have added too much complexity to the code, making it less readable and more fragile.
If a different convention is needed, identify names via search/grep (e.g. with `^\s+name\s+=\s+"`) and change them in an editor: it should take a couple of minutes at most, as there's just a handful of modules and resources to change.
Names used in internal references (e.g. `module.foo-prod.id`) are only used by Terraform and do not influence resource naming, so they are best left untouched to avoid having to debug complex errors.

### CI/CD repositories
FAST is designed to directly support running in automated workflows from separate repositories for each stage. The `cicd_repositories` variable allows you to configure impersonation from external repositories leveraging Workload identity Federation, and pre-configures a FAST workflow file that can be used to validate and apply the code in each repository.
The repository design we support is fairly simple, with a repository for modules that enables centralization and versioning, and one repository for each stage optionally configured from the previous stage.
This is an example of configuring the bootstrap and resource management repositories in this stage. CI/CD configuration is optional, so the entire variable or any of its attributes can be set to null if not needed.
